WebLearning points. Frank's sign is a diagonal earlobe crease that extends 45° backwards from the tragus to the auricle, which is hypothesised to be a predictor of atherosclerotic disease. Large population prospective study has shown significant association of Frank's sign with increased risks of ischaemic heart disease and myocardial infarctions. WebJul 1, 2014 · Bilateral Earlobe Creases and Coronary Artery Disease. A 73-year–old man with a history of hypertension and a family history of coronary artery disease (CAD) was seen in an outpatient clinic for stable angina. Physical examination showed bilateral earlobe creases, known as Frank’s sign ( Figure 1 ), and no other relevant cardiac findings. WebDec 30, 2024 · It is called Frank’s Sign after Dr. Sanders T. Frank who observed this crease on 20 patients with angina (1). Studies also call this sign DELC (Diagonal Earlobe Crease) and have found it prevalent in coronary artery disease, peripheral vascular disease and cerebrovascular disease (2,3,4). WebAug 13, 2014 · The modern day approach to detecting heart disease has likely limited the usefulness of Frank’s sign. Although the earlobe crease may be associated with coronary artery disease (CAD), its sensitivity for detecting this is nowhere near that of stress tests, CT scores, or angiograms.
